Searched refs:i2c_adap (Results 126 - 150 of 206) sorted by relevance

123456789

/linux-master/drivers/net/ethernet/sfc/falcon/
H A Dfalcon.c2385 board->i2c_adap.owner = THIS_MODULE;
2388 board->i2c_adap.algo_data = &board->i2c_data;
2389 board->i2c_adap.dev.parent = &efx->pci_dev->dev;
2390 strscpy(board->i2c_adap.name, "SFC4000 GPIO",
2391 sizeof(board->i2c_adap.name));
2392 rc = i2c_bit_add_bus(&board->i2c_adap);
2409 i2c_del_adapter(&board->i2c_adap);
2410 memset(&board->i2c_adap, 0, sizeof(board->i2c_adap));
2549 i2c_del_adapter(&board->i2c_adap);
[all...]
/linux-master/drivers/media/usb/dvb-usb/
H A Dtechnisat-usb2.c436 if (i2c_transfer(&d->i2c_adap, msg, 2) != 2)
524 &a->dev->i2c_adap, STV090x_DEMODULATOR_0);
532 &a->dev->i2c_adap);
H A Dpctv452e.c919 &a->dev->i2c_adap);
928 &a->dev->i2c_adap) == NULL) {
935 &a->dev->i2c_adap,
948 &a->dev->i2c_adap) == NULL) {
H A Ddvb-usb.h446 * @i2c_adap: device's i2c_adapter if it uses I2CoverUSB
481 struct i2c_adapter i2c_adap; member in struct:dvb_usb_device
/linux-master/drivers/media/platform/renesas/
H A Dsh_vou.c1223 struct i2c_adapter *i2c_adap; local
1313 i2c_adap = i2c_get_adapter(vou_pdata->i2c_adap);
1314 if (!i2c_adap) {
1323 subdev = v4l2_i2c_new_subdev_board(&vou_dev->v4l2_dev, i2c_adap,
1339 i2c_put_adapter(i2c_adap);
/linux-master/drivers/media/tuners/
H A Dtda9887.c676 struct i2c_adapter *i2c_adap,
686 i2c_adap, i2c_addr, "tda9887");
675 tda9887_attach(struct dvb_frontend *fe, struct i2c_adapter *i2c_adap, u8 i2c_addr) argument
H A Dtda8290.c731 struct i2c_adapter *i2c_adap, u8 i2c_addr,
743 priv->i2c_props.adap = i2c_adap;
820 int tda829x_probe(struct i2c_adapter *i2c_adap, u8 i2c_addr) argument
823 .adap = i2c_adap,
730 tda829x_attach(struct dvb_frontend *fe, struct i2c_adapter *i2c_adap, u8 i2c_addr, struct tda829x_config *cfg) argument
H A Dmt20xx.c591 struct i2c_adapter* i2c_adap,
605 priv->i2c_props.adap = i2c_adap;
590 microtune_attach(struct dvb_frontend *fe, struct i2c_adapter* i2c_adap, u8 i2c_addr) argument
/linux-master/drivers/media/pci/bt8xx/
H A Dbttv-input.c389 i2c_dev = i2c_new_client_device(&btv->c.i2c_adap, &info);
399 i2c_dev = i2c_new_scanned_device(&btv->c.i2c_adap, &info, addr_list, NULL);
/linux-master/drivers/media/dvb-frontends/
H A Dlgdt3306a.c64 struct i2c_adapter *i2c_adap; member in struct:lgdt3306a_state
134 ret = i2c_transfer(state->i2c_adap, &msg, 1);
158 ret = i2c_transfer(state->i2c_adap, msg, 2);
1795 struct i2c_adapter *i2c_adap)
1802 i2c_adap ? i2c_adapter_id(i2c_adap) : 0,
1810 state->i2c_adap = i2c_adap;
1794 lgdt3306a_attach(const struct lgdt3306a_config *config, struct i2c_adapter *i2c_adap) argument
H A Dstv090x_priv.h222 struct i2c_adapter *i2c_adap; member in struct:stv090x_internal
H A Ddib8000.c1673 static int dib8096p_tuner_write_serpar(struct i2c_adapter *i2c_adap, argument
1676 struct dib8000_state *state = i2c_get_adapdata(i2c_adap);
1693 static int dib8096p_tuner_read_serpar(struct i2c_adapter *i2c_adap, argument
1696 struct dib8000_state *state = i2c_get_adapdata(i2c_adap);
1725 static int dib8096p_tuner_rw_serpar(struct i2c_adapter *i2c_adap, argument
1730 return dib8096p_tuner_write_serpar(i2c_adap, msg, 1);
1732 return dib8096p_tuner_read_serpar(i2c_adap, msg, 2);
1737 static int dib8096p_rw_on_apb(struct i2c_adapter *i2c_adap, argument
1740 struct dib8000_state *state = i2c_get_adapdata(i2c_adap);
1754 static int dib8096p_tuner_xfer(struct i2c_adapter *i2c_adap, argument
4440 dib8000_init(struct i2c_adapter *i2c_adap, u8 i2c_addr, struct dib8000_config *cfg) argument
[all...]
H A Dmb86a16.c23 struct i2c_adapter *i2c_adap; member in struct:mb86a16_state
78 ret = i2c_transfer(state->i2c_adap, &msg, 1);
102 ret = i2c_transfer(state->i2c_adap, msg, 2);
1831 struct i2c_adapter *i2c_adap)
1841 state->i2c_adap = i2c_adap;
1830 mb86a16_attach(const struct mb86a16_config *config, struct i2c_adapter *i2c_adap) argument
/linux-master/drivers/media/usb/pvrusb2/
H A Dpvrusb2-hdw-internal.h183 struct i2c_adapter i2c_adap; member in struct:pvr2_hdw
/linux-master/drivers/net/ethernet/intel/igb/
H A Digb_hwmon.c201 client = i2c_new_client_device(&adapter->i2c_adap, &i350_sensor_info);
/linux-master/drivers/media/usb/dvb-usb-v2/
H A Ddvb_usb.h367 * @i2c_adap: device's i2c-adapter
390 struct i2c_adapter i2c_adap; member in struct:dvb_usb_device
H A Dmxl111sf.c474 &d->i2c_adap);
549 &d->i2c_adap);
636 &d->i2c_adap);
723 &d->i2c_adap);
943 ret = i2c_transfer(&d->i2c_adap, msg, 2);
/linux-master/drivers/staging/media/av7110/
H A Dav7110.h102 struct i2c_adapter i2c_adap; member in struct:av7110
H A Dav7110_v4l.c43 if (i2c_transfer(&av7110->i2c_adap, &msgs, 1) != 1) {
73 if (i2c_transfer(&av7110->i2c_adap, &msgs[0], 2) != 2) {
130 if (1 != i2c_transfer(&av7110->i2c_adap, &msg, 1))
142 if (1 != i2c_transfer(&av7110->i2c_adap, &msg, 1))
/linux-master/drivers/i2c/busses/
H A Di2c-st.c337 static int st_i2c_recover_bus(struct i2c_adapter *i2c_adap) argument
339 struct st_i2c_dev *i2c_dev = i2c_get_adapdata(i2c_adap);
706 * @i2c_adap: Adapter pointer to the controller
710 static int st_i2c_xfer(struct i2c_adapter *i2c_adap, argument
713 struct st_i2c_dev *i2c_dev = i2c_get_adapdata(i2c_adap);
H A Di2c-stm32f7.c851 static void stm32f7_i2c_release_bus(struct i2c_adapter *i2c_adap) argument
853 struct stm32f7_i2c_dev *i2c_dev = i2c_get_adapdata(i2c_adap);
1704 static int stm32f7_i2c_xfer_core(struct i2c_adapter *i2c_adap, argument
1707 struct stm32f7_i2c_dev *i2c_dev = i2c_get_adapdata(i2c_adap);
1765 static int stm32f7_i2c_xfer(struct i2c_adapter *i2c_adap, argument
1768 struct stm32f7_i2c_dev *i2c_dev = i2c_get_adapdata(i2c_adap);
1771 return stm32f7_i2c_xfer_core(i2c_adap, msgs, num);
1774 static int stm32f7_i2c_xfer_atomic(struct i2c_adapter *i2c_adap, argument
1777 struct stm32f7_i2c_dev *i2c_dev = i2c_get_adapdata(i2c_adap);
1780 return stm32f7_i2c_xfer_core(i2c_adap, msg
[all...]
H A Di2c-stm32f4.c721 * @i2c_adap: Adapter pointer to the controller
725 static int stm32f4_i2c_xfer(struct i2c_adapter *i2c_adap, struct i2c_msg msgs[], argument
728 struct stm32f4_i2c_dev *i2c_dev = i2c_get_adapdata(i2c_adap);
/linux-master/drivers/media/pci/cx88/
H A Dcx88-input.c637 if (i2c_smbus_xfer(&core->i2c_adap, *addrp, 0,
641 i2c_new_client_device(&core->i2c_adap, &info);
/linux-master/drivers/media/usb/em28xx/
H A Dem28xx-video.c2571 &dev->i2c_adap[dev->def_i2c_bus],
2576 &dev->i2c_adap[dev->def_i2c_bus],
2581 &dev->i2c_adap[dev->def_i2c_bus],
2586 &dev->i2c_adap[dev->def_i2c_bus],
2597 &dev->i2c_adap[dev->def_i2c_bus],
2603 &dev->i2c_adap[dev->def_i2c_bus],
2612 &dev->i2c_adap[dev->def_i2c_bus],
2620 &dev->i2c_adap[dev->def_i2c_bus],
/linux-master/drivers/media/pci/saa7134/
H A Dsaa7134-cards.c7799 ret = i2c_transfer(&dev->i2c_adap, msg, 2);
7806 i2c_transfer(&dev->i2c_adap, msg, 2);
7823 i2c_transfer(&dev->i2c_adap, msg, 2);
7826 i2c_transfer(&dev->i2c_adap, msg, 2);
7853 if (i2c_transfer(&dev->i2c_adap, &msg1, 1) != 1)
7880 i2c_transfer(&dev->i2c_adap, &msg, 1);
7898 i2c_transfer(&dev->i2c_adap, &msg, 1);
7901 i2c_transfer(&dev->i2c_adap, &msg, 1);
7942 i2c_transfer(&dev->i2c_adap, &msg, 1);
7950 i2c_transfer(&dev->i2c_adap,
[all...]

Completed in 298 milliseconds

123456789